Are You Tired of the Cold Weather? • On your bar graph, plot the temperature for the past week. • Monday 54 degrees • Tuesday 56 degrees • Wednesday 48 degrees • Thursday 45 degrees • Friday 63 degrees • Saturday 50 degrees • Sunday 47 degrees • During Morning Meeting we will be talking about what you notice on the • graph. What’s your prediction for tomorrow’s temperature? What do you • Think the temperature is now? complete the graph at your desk and bring • it to Morning Meeting. One lucky person will be chosen to record the • temperature.

  3. News and announcements: IS IT RIGHT OR WRITE? Homophones are words that sound the same but have different spellings and meanings. To explain what each homophone means, first draw a picture of it. A picture can help you understand what the word means. Then use the word in a sentence. Be sure to check your spelling!
